Cut the remaining butter into small pieces, place it in a bowl, and soften it using a spatula or a wooden spoon.<\/p>\n<p>Next, add the sifted flour, baking powder, and two pinches of salt. Gradually pour in the milk, mixing well until you obtain a smooth and soft dough. Cover the dough with a clean kitchen towel and let it rest for about 1 hour.<\/p>\n<p>Once rested, roll out the dough with a rolling pin to a thickness of about 1\u00bd cm (\u00bd inch). Using a round cookie cutter, cut out circles about 6 cm (2\u00bd inches) in diameter, or alternatively cut the dough into triangles with a sharp knife. You should obtain about 12 scones.<\/p>\n<p>Place the scones on a greased baking tray and bake in a preheated oven at 180\u00b0C (350\u00b0F) for about 15 minutes. Remove them from the oven and dust with powdered sugar. Your scones are now ready to be served.<\/p>\n<h4>Helpful Tips for Perfect Scones:<\/h4>\n<p>Use cold butter if you prefer flakier scones: For a more crumbly and layered texture, you can use cold butter instead of softened butter and work it quickly into the flour.<\/p>\n<p>Do not overmix the dough: Mixing too much can make the scones tough. Stop as soon as the dough comes together.<\/p>\n<p>Let the dough rest: Resting the dough helps the gluten relax.<\/p>\n<p>Customize the flavor: You can add chocolate chips, dried fruit, or lemon zest to the dough for a flavorful twist.<\/p>\n<p>Serve fresh: Scones taste best when enjoyed warm, served with butter, jam, or clotted cream.<\/p>\n<p>Storage tip: Store leftover in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days, or freeze them for longer storage.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>To prepare the scones, start by taking the butter and setting aside a small amount to grease the baking pan.
